5 units would be easier for the sitter to measure. Just in case, leave a sample syringe filled with coloured liquid to 5 units. I would not do the "no shoot" for exactly the reason you suggested. Given that she's on Lev so a later nadir, and she hasn't seen a preshot below 200 this month, it's not that likely to happen. You could suggest perhaps a one time only reduced dose if below a certain number. Having said that, 2 out of 3 of her last limes came with preshots above 200. :rolleyes: I like your idea of feeding higher carb food instead. Higher carbs aren't a part of the ketones issue.
